What if the best medicine isn’t found inside a hospital—but outside, in your neighborhood?
Healthcare workers didn’t choose their profession for the paperwork. They came to heal. Now, many are searching for a way back to that purpose.
Game Changers reveals a powerful solution already transforming lives: mobile healthcare. From city blocks to rural roads, a new model of medicine is emerging, with clinicians bringing care directly to patients, rebuilding trust, and closing access gaps once thought impossible to fix.
Travis and Amanda LeFever share their personal journey and introduce the pioneers who are changing healthcare by returning to its roots: neighbors caring for neighbors. This is a movement fueled by compassion and backed by a proven, scalable business model.
Whether you're a provider, policymaker, or community leader, this book shows how mobile health can reduce burnout, lower costs, improve outcomes, and restore dignity to care.

TRAVIS LEFEVER is co-founder of Mission Mobile Medical Group, an international leader in mobile healthcare innovation. Together with Amanda LeFever, they’ve helped transform how care reaches underserved communities—one neighborhood at a time. Their mission-driven leadership honors a legacy of service, compassion, and the belief that healthcare should meet people where they are.

DON YAEGER is a thirteen-time New York Times bestselling author, Hall of Fame keynote speaker, executive coach, Publisher at Advantage Media, and longtime Associate Editor of Sports Illustrated. Named National Geographic's Storyteller in Residence, he has spent decades studying and practicing the habits of the world's greatest communicators. He hosts the top-rated Corporate Competitor Podcast and leads Greatness Inc. from his home in Tallahassee, Florida.
